Vandals should never enter the cemetery at night.
Chucky knew he was scared. He had no volition to enter the cemetery that night, but his buddies, Jamal and Randall, were bored, plus they'd been drinking. Chucky was a lightweight with more sense in his little finger than both of them together, but he was also a follower, too wimpy to stand up for himself. Their plan - to tag a few headstones then get out of dodge.

The heat that night was unbearable, but they strolled to the cemetery and jumped over the gate. Chucky nervously followed behind, shushing the two jokers along the way. Randall pointed to a stumpy white mausoleum and ran toward it with Jamal giggling on his heels. Together, their spray paint cans spelled out some unintelligible symbols which Chucky found strange.

The hairs on Chucky's neck stood on end like something was behind him. He turned. The door to the mausoleum stood open. Chucky jumped back then yelled,

"Look out!"

He darted from the cemetery, hopping over the fence just as a patrol car drove by. On went it's lights and Chucky halted. Two cops approached him and told him to take a seat on the curb, but Chucky didn't want to be interrogated in front of the cemetery.

"What were you doing in there?"

"I...I was running out. I followed two of my friends in there so they could spray paint some headstones."

"Vandalism, is it?"

"Yes, I guess so, but something happened?"

"Where are your buddies?"

"They came and got them."

"Who came and got them?"

Chucky turned back and pointed. "The dead people. The dead people came out of the mausoleum and pulled them in."

"Are you joking?"

"Look at my hands." He stuck out both hands. They wouldn't stop shaking. "Can you take me away from here?" Chucky asked.
